Why Renting Snowboarding Gear Makes Sense

Renting snowboarding gear offers numerous benefits for beginners and seasoned riders alike. Firstly, it allows individuals to try out different types of equipment without the long-term commitment of purchasing. This is particularly useful for those who are unsure about their riding style or the type of terrain they will be covering.

The Mechanics of Renting

The renting process typically involves visiting a local equipment shop or website, selecting the desired gear, and renting it for the duration of their stay. Many rental shops also offer package deals that include equipment, lessons, and even lift tickets, making it easier for newcomers to get started.

Types of Rentals Available

  • One-day rentals: Perfect for those who only need gear for a single day on the slopes.
  • Multi-day rentals: Ideal for longer trips or for those who plan to hit the slopes frequently.
  • Season passes: A great option for frequent riders who can enjoy unlimited rentals throughout the season.

Factors to Consider When Renting

When renting snowboarding gear, there are several factors to consider to 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ience. These include the type of terrain you will be riding on, the quality of the equipment, and the rental shop’s reputation and customer service.

Quality of Equipment

The quality of the equipment rented is crucial to ensure a safe and enjoyable experience. Look for rental shops that offer high-quality gear, including helmets, boots, bindings, and boards. Some rental shops may also offer demo equipment, which is brand new and barely used.

Myths and Misconceptions

There are several myths and misconceptions surrounding renting snowboarding gear on a budget. One common misconception is that renting is only suitable for beginners, when in fact, many experienced riders also opt for rentals to try out new equipment or to enjoy a day on the slopes without the long-term commitment of purchasing.
